#178133 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#178133 is composed of 9% red, 50.6%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 135.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 29.8%. #178133 color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ff66 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#178133 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#178133 has RGB values of R:23, G:129,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1540403.

Shades and Tints of #178133
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c05 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#178133
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4c4c is the less saturated color, while #05932b is the most saturated one.
